Nope , definitely wild-trapped. And as an added bonus for your $5 you get Megabacteria, coccidia and any choice of bacterial and fungal bugs all for free!!!!

A little cynical, perhaps, but wild-caught goldfinches stress easily and often succumb to these bugs so if you buy any make sure you quarantine them properly away from the rest of your birds.
